At Caltech, homework was assigned but had no bearing on your grade. The grades were based on the midterm and final exams.

But not mastering the homework usually resulted in flunking the exams. There were "retch" sessions after each homework assignment that was staffed by a grad student, and the purpose was to help the students understand the homework problems. I knew only one person (Hal Finney) who was so smart he didn't need to do the homework.

I learned the hard way that the path to success was:

1. never miss a lecture, no matter what

2. take notes by hand during lecture

3. do the homework on time, and make sure you understand every problem. Take advantage of the retch sessions.

And that worked for me.

  • Likewise at Oxford - only the final exams counted (though you had to pass first year exams to continue to the second year).

    But you had tutorials each week, and if your tutors thought you weren't doing enough work they could set you exams mid-course called 'penal collections' and if you failed them you could be thrown out. They were rare but definitely not unknown.

  • Naval Nuclear Power School had (maybe still does) this model 20 years ago as well. Pass rate for my class cohort was 28% over the entire 2 year pipeline.

    We didn't call them retch sessions, and they were taught by the instructors though. We also were encouraged to peer tutor and since we were all restricted to one building the homework was always group work allowed.

    Also had badges to track time spent in the building for required study hours, though some people gave up and just slept at their desks when they started sliding down the grade scale and the hours racked up.

    Generally I think I did 30 hours of studying/homework (went up and down depending on what was being taught, but was around that) a week (for 12-15 hours of actual lecturing), with some of my friends putting in 50% more. Generally the only day we weren't there was Saturdays. Most of the day Sunday was usually spent in class preparing for the next week.

Unlimited retakes would be an enormous amount of work for professors/TAs/teachers.

Optional homework is often a disaster. At best, students would do it right before an exam and the goal of education is not to just pass exams. They’d probably still get a lower score than if they did the homework when they were supposed to.

What I think is better is to have a due date, but just make the maximum 10% each day it is late. So after 2 days, the highest score you could receive would be 80%.

I liked that system because it gave some flexibility with deadlines while still encouraging you to turn things in on time.

The study was done in China, where making the class easier to improve pass rates isn't really a thing, as the Gaokao operates more like a stack ranking where it doesn't matter much how well you did in an absolute sense, only that not too many others who did better than you are competing for the same spot. Unlimited retakes are possible in theory, except each costs you a year of your life and except for some extreme cases of repeat test-takers, most people are going to give up after just one or two bad results. Homework is definitely not optional, but going home from school is. (Due to the hukou system, children often have to go to school far from where their parents work, so boarding schools with teacher-supervised self-study are common.)
